If you’re looking to provide your xbox with additional storage for Starfield but can’t afford the extortionate expansion cards then Seagate has some new Starfield-themed storage options just for you.
The new Starfield Special Edition Game Drive enables you to expand your xbox storage with a bit of added Starfield flair. The design is all white with artwork commemorating the explorers from Constellation and features an orange rim on the underside of the drive and features custom RGB LED lighting. The drives are available with up to 5TB of HDD storage and is connected and powered by a USB 3.2 Gen 1 connection fully compatible with Xbox Series X/S and Xbox One.
The other available option is the Game Hub which offers 8TB of capacity and is designed for those who have a lot of games that they would like ready to go. The game hub is also powered by a USB 3.2 Gen 1 connection and features a front-facing USB-A port allowing for other peripherals to be connected and powered. The Game hub can be used vertically or horizontally giving more flexibility in your gaming setup.
The new drives include three-years of Rescue Data Recovery Services and a one-year limited warranty, giving gamers peace of mind. With pre-orders starting today and wide availability in September, the Seagate Starfield Special Edition Game Drive for Xbox is available in capacities of 2 TB (US$109.99) and 5 TB (US$169.99) and the Seagate Starfield Special Edition Game Hub for Xbox is available in an 8 TB (US$239.99) capacity.
